- The distance between Townsville, Queensland, Australia and Hanmer Forest, New Zealand is approximately 3,561 km or 2,213 mi.
- To reach Townsville, Queensland in this distance one would set out from Hanmer Forest bearing 308.5° or NW and follow the great circles arc to approach Townsville, Queensland bearing 322.3° or NW .
- Townsville, Queensland has a tropical wet and dry/ savanna climate with dry winters (Aw) whereas Hanmer Forest has a marine west coast climate (Cfb).
- Townsville, Queensland is in or near the subtropical moist forest biome whereas Hanmer Forest is in or near the cool temperate steppe biome.
- The mean temperature is 14 °C (25.1°F) warmer.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 2.9 °C (5.2°F) less in Townsville, Queensland. The continentality subtype is barely hyperoceanic as opposed to truly oceanic.
- Total annual precipitation averages 115.1 mm (4.5 in) less which is equivalent to 115.1 l/m² (2.82 US gal/ft²) or 1,151,000 l/ha (123,050 US gal/ac) less. About 1 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 21.8° higher in Townsville, Queensland than in Hanmer Forest.
